NettetJohn Schiffer completed his Ph.D. in 1954 at Yale University, followed by post-doctoral work at The Rice Institute. Since 1956, he has been at Argonne National Laboratory. He also holds a joint appointment at the University of Chicago. He is a fellow of the APS and the AAAS, as well as several other societies, and a recipient of, among others ... NettetNuclear Physics. NettetJohn Paul Schiffer, American Physicist. Research on nuclear structure, Mössbauer effect, heavy-ion reactions, pion interactions in nuclei, quark searches, condensation in confined cold plasmas.
